From cb16cabb64e99d7f505822a49665725ff5b61ff6 Mon Sep 17 00:00:00 2001
From: 648540858 <648540858@qq.com>
Date: 星期一, 15 八月 2022 15:37:13 +0800
Subject: [PATCH] Merge branch 'wvp-28181-2.0'
---
web_src/src/components/dialog/devicePlayer.vue | 9 +++++++--
1 files changed, 7 insertions(+), 2 deletions(-)
diff --git a/web_src/src/components/dialog/devicePlayer.vue b/web_src/src/components/dialog/devicePlayer.vue
index d5a3ff4..c11df1d 100644
--- a/web_src/src/components/dialog/devicePlayer.vue
+++ b/web_src/src/components/dialog/devicePlayer.vue
@@ -298,6 +298,7 @@
<script>
import rtcPlayer from '../dialog/rtcPlayer.vue'
+import crypto from 'crypto'
// import LivePlayer from '@liveqing/liveplayer'
// import player from '../dialog/easyPlayer.vue'
import jessibucaPlayer from '../common/jessibuca.vue'
@@ -388,7 +389,7 @@
url: '/zlm/' +this.mediaServerId+ '/index/api/getMediaInfo?vhost=__defaultVhost__&schema=rtmp&app='+ this.app +'&stream='+ this.streamId
}).then(function (res) {
that.tracksLoading = false;
- if (res.data.code == 0 && res.data.online) {
+ if (res.data.code == 0 && res.data.tracks) {
that.tracks = res.data.tracks;
}else{
that.tracksNotLoaded = true;
@@ -861,6 +862,10 @@
}
},
startBroadcast(url){
+ // 鑾峰彇鎺ㄦ祦閴存潈KEY
+ console.log(this.$loginUser)
+ console.log(this.$loginUser.pushKey)
+ url += "&sign=" + crypto.createHash('md5').update(this.$loginUser.pushKey, "utf8").digest('hex')
console.log("寮�濮嬭闊冲璁诧細 " + url)
this.broadcastRtc = new ZLMRTCClient.Endpoint({
debug: true, // 鏄惁鎵撳嵃鏃ュ織
@@ -915,7 +920,7 @@
this.broadcastStatus = 0;
}else if (e === "connected") {
this.broadcastStatus = 1;
- }else {
+ }else if (e === "disconnected") {
this.broadcastStatus = -1;
}
});
--
Gitblit v1.8.0